M1511-6_1.jpg Fig1: ICC staining of ICAM1 in Hela cells (green). Formalin fixed cells were permeabilized with 0.1% Triton X-100 in TBS for 10 minutes at room temperature and blocked with 1% Blocker BSA for 15 minutes at room temperature. Cells were probed with the primary antibody (M1511-6, 1/100) for 1 hour at room temperature, washed with PBS. Alexa Fluor®488 Goat anti-Mouse IgG was used as the secondary antibody at 1/1,000 dilution. The nuclear counter stain is DAPI (blue).

M1511-6_4.jpg Fig4: Western blot analysis of ICAM1 on different lysates with Mouse anti-ICAM1 antibody (M1511-6) at 1/1,000 dilution.

Lane 1: Daudi (Human Burkitt's lymphoma cells) cell lysate

Lysates/proteins at 20 µg/Lane.
Exposure time: 20 seconds; ECL: K1801


Blocking: 5% NFDM/TBST, 1 hour at room temperature
Primary antibody: M1511-6, 1/1,000 in 5% NFDM/TBST, overnight at 4 ℃
Secondary antibody: Goat anti-Mouse IgG-HRP (HA1006), 1/50,000 in 5% NFDM/TBST, 1 hour at room temperature

Predicted band size: 58 kDa
Observed band size: 58 kDa
